2 is company
Paul may be a blonde, baby-faced boy of 20, but he is fastidiously German and is by all means the head volunteer. This übermench is kind, clean, good natured, laid-back, attractive, organized, a fabulous chef, didn´t know a word of Spanish the day he arrived 10 months ago and is now totally proficient, better than I am. Also fluent in English. When he returns to Germany at the end of the summer, he´s going to school for mechanical engineering. After a hard day of farmwork, he likes to go to the gym in Cayambe. The übermench is, I think, better than I at everthing except for expressing his feelings with words. Needless to say, we have little to talk about. This week, it´s just him and me in the volunteer house, so it´s very quiet except for the übermench´s dance techno music, eminating gently from his spotless room.
